8 smart-home gadgets that can keep a microphone or camera live

Smart-home convenience arrives with a quiet trade-off: many popular gadgets keep a microphone or camera powered on so they can respond the instant they are needed. Most listen for a wake word or watch a doorway around the clock, buffering or streaming as they go. Here are eight devices that keep a sensor live inside the home.

1. Amazon Echo: The Always-Listening Speaker

The Amazon Echo runs a far-field microphone array that continuously samples the room, listening locally for the “Alexa” wake word before any audio travels to the cloud. Amazon’s smart speaker line keeps that on-device listening active whenever the unit is powered, which is how it can answer within a second of hearing its name.

Owners can silence the microphones with a physical button that cuts power to the array, and Amazon lets users review and delete stored voice clips. Even so, the default state is a speaker that is always sampling nearby sound, and misfires on words that resemble the wake phrase can trigger recordings nobody intended to start.

2. Google Nest Hub: The Screen That Keeps Listening

A Google Nest Hub pairs a touchscreen with an always-ready microphone tuned for the “Hey Google” phrase, surfacing reminders, recipes and video calls on command. Google’s Nest speaker family processes that wake word on the device itself, then streams the request that follows to its servers for interpretation.

The base Nest Hub deliberately ships without a camera, a design choice aimed at bedroom and kitchen placement. The microphone, however, stays live unless the hardware switch is flipped, and the display’s ambient sensing means the device is continuously aware of movement and light in the room around it.

3. Ring Video Doorbell: The Camera at the Front Door

A Ring Video Doorbell trains a camera and microphone on the porch, recording motion-triggered clips and enabling two-way audio with whoever approaches. The Amazon-owned doorbell uploads footage to the cloud, where subscribers review it, and it captures both video and sound whenever its motion zones detect activity outside.

Ring cameras have drawn scrutiny over police-partnership programs that once made shared footage easy to request, prompting the company to rework how those requests function. For the household, the practical point is a lens and mic pointed outward at all hours, catching visitors, passersby and conversations within range of the doorway.

4. Google Nest Cam: The Continuous Home Watch

A Google Nest Cam is built to monitor a room or yard, streaming video and detecting motion, people and familiar faces on higher tiers. Google’s home security camera can record continuously for subscribers, keeping its lens and microphone active so events are captured the moment they occur.

Nest Cam footage is encrypted in transit and storage, and owners can define activity zones or pause the camera through the Home app. Even then, a camera designed for round-the-clock coverage is by definition a live sensor in the house, and any always-on recorder becomes a target the instant an account is compromised.

5. Amazon Echo Show: The Display With a Live Lens

The Amazon Echo Show adds a front-facing camera to the Echo’s always-listening microphones, powering video calls and a “drop in” feature that can open a live feed between trusted contacts. Amazon’s smart display keeps the mic ready for the wake word and the camera available for calls whenever the screen is on.

A sliding shutter physically covers the lens on most models, and the mute button cuts the microphone array, giving owners a hardware off switch. The risk is convenience-by-default: the drop-in feature and always-ready sensors let a screen in the kitchen or bedroom become an open window unless those controls are used deliberately.

6. Apple HomePod: The Far-Field Microphones

The Apple HomePod listens through an array of far-field microphones that wait for “Hey Siri,” using on-device processing to detect the phrase before a request reaches Apple. The voice-controlled speaker keeps those mics powered so it can hear commands across a room, even over its own music playback.

Apple stresses that Siri requests tie to a random identifier rather than an Apple ID, and a top-panel control mutes listening. Yet the speaker’s entire premise is an always-on microphone that must sample ambient sound to catch its wake phrase, which plants a live sensor wherever the HomePod happens to sit.

7. Wyze Cam: The Budget Always-On Camera

The Wyze Cam packs continuous video, night vision and motion alerts into an inexpensive cube, making an always-on camera cheap enough to place in several rooms at once. The low-cost home camera streams to the cloud and can record locally to a memory card, keeping its lens and mic active by design.

Wyze has disclosed security lapses, including an incident that briefly let some users glimpse strangers’ camera feeds, underscoring the stakes of a cheap networked recorder. Because the cameras are often bought in bulk and scattered through a home, a single account or firmware weakness can expose several live feeds simultaneously.

8. Samsung SmartThings: The Hub Tying the Sensors Together

Samsung SmartThings acts as the connective layer of a smart home, linking cameras, microphones, locks and sensors from many brands under one app and automation engine. The SmartThings platform routes triggers and live feeds between devices, so an always-on camera or a listening speaker becomes part of a single coordinated system.

That coordination is both the convenience and the exposure: a hub that can view camera streams and toggle devices centralizes access to every live sensor it manages. Should the SmartThings account or a connected device be breached, an intruder potentially reaches the whole network of mics and cameras rather than one isolated gadget.
